Why this detail page matters
The product logic behind showing a standalone tower page instead of burying the record in a generic list.
- Exact ASR structures and crowdsourced-only nodes are both listed, with the difference labeled rather than hidden.
- Tower owner is often a neutral host like Crown Castle or American Tower, not the wireless carrier itself.
- Coverage ranges here are rough carrier-level estimates derived from reported cell radii. Treat them as indicative, not exact.
